Railings are the most-touched metal in a building and the first thing an inspector looks at. Height, spacing and load all have to meet Massachusetts building code — which is why we match railing requests with shops that build to code every day, not occasionally.
Straight-run, curved and open-riser stair rails in steel, wrought iron or stainless.
Exterior railings finished to survive New England winters and salt air.
Stainless cable systems for clear sightlines on decks, stairs and balconies.
Guardrails for balconies, mezzanines and elevated walkways.
Graspable, continuous handrails for commercial and accessible entries.
Re-welding loose posts, replacing rusted rails and matching existing profiles.

Requirements vary by occupancy and whether the railing is a guard or a handrail, and your local inspector has final say. Your matched shop builds to the current Massachusetts building code and will confirm the spec for your specific application before fabricating.
Usually yes. Send photos of the existing profile and a rough measurement — most shops can replicate or closely match older patterns when replacing a damaged section.
Typical residential railings run a few weeks from measure to install, depending on finish and the shop's backlog. Repairs are often much faster.
